| Color |
| Adjust the shade of white the display produces. |
| Temperature |
| 9300 K — Slightly purplish white. |
|
|
| |
|
|
| 8000 K — Slightly bluish white |
|
|
| 6500 K — Standard |
|
|
| User - Set the R, G, B gain values yourself |
|
|
| The default setting is 9300. |

| Energy Saving |
| Select from the following backlight brightness levels: |
|
|
| ● Off — 100% light |
|
|
| ● Level 1 — 80% light |
|
|
| ● Level 2 — 60% light |
|
|
| ● Level 3 — 40% light |
|
|
| The default setting is Off. |
|
|
|
|
| Local Dimming |
| On — Allows the display to dynamically change brightness in |
|
|
| selected areas of the screen to enhance detail in both dark |
|
|
| and bright parts of the image at once. |
|
|
| Off — No local dimming. |
|
|
| The default setting is Off. |

Audio | Volume |
| Adjust the volume from 0 to 100. |
|
|
| The default setting is 50. |
|
|
|
|
| Speaker |
| On — Play sound through the attached speakers. |
|
|
| Off — Turn off attached speakers in order to use an external |
|
|
| sound system. |
|
|
| The default setting is On. |

| Balance |
| Balances sound between the left and right speakers. |
|
|
| The default setting is 50; range is 0 – 100, with 0 being all |
|
|
| sound from the left speaker. |
